Ordinals
beta
Sat 1984794696870868
decimal
891343.9370868
degree
0°51343′271″9370868‴
percentile
94.51403328829254%
name
ueqphuiivd
cycle
0
epoch
4
period
442
block
891343
offset
9370868
timestamp
2025-04-07 12:49:44 UTC
rarity
common
prev
next